Transaction 531e861089f7b10ded58d2cf4ee2c5a06a40cd800f79e1298b0c5513982112f9

2 Input
2 Outputs
  • 531e861089f7b10ded58d2cf4ee2c5a06a40cd800f79e1298b0c5513982112f9:0
  • value  19577
    address  17AAX3ooGS8fp9Pab5zQdRRUS4osx4cEq8
  • 531e861089f7b10ded58d2cf4ee2c5a06a40cd800f79e1298b0c5513982112f9:1
  • value  128800
    address  1Drv3iyDtJ9Ytr6QdAQVvm8QekBHGRbyuA